Is it legal to use cryptocurrency for online pokies in Australia?
Yes, it is legal for players. The Interactive Gambling Act 2001 (IGA) regulates operators, not players. You are not breaking the law by depositing Bitcoin to play pokies at an offshore casino. However, Australian-licensed casinos cannot offer online pokies to residents. So you will be using an offshore site. That is standard practice for most Aussie players.
